What is Task Management & Time Tracking? — Definition & Key Capabilities

Task management and time tracking are integrated business software solutions designed to plan, organize, and monitor work activities while recording associated labor hours. These platforms typically feature tools for creating task lists, assigning responsibilities, setting deadlines, and generating detailed reports on time expenditure. The combined use of these systems enhances operational transparency, improves project forecasting accuracy, and boosts overall team productivity and accountability.

How Task Management & Time Tracking Services Work

1
Step 1

Define Project Scope and Tasks

Teams break down projects into individual, actionable tasks, assign them to members, and set clear priorities and deadlines for completion.

2
Step 2

Track Time and Progress

Team members log time against specific tasks, either manually or automatically, while managers monitor real-time progress against the project plan.

3
Step 3

Analyze Data and Optimize

The system aggregates data to generate insights on project costs, team performance, and bottlenecks, enabling data-driven process improvements.

Who Benefits from Task Management & Time Tracking?

Professional Services & Agencies

Agencies use these tools to track billable hours accurately across multiple client projects, ensuring precise invoicing and profitability analysis.

Software Development Teams

Dev teams apply them within Agile or Scrum frameworks to manage sprints, track time per feature, and estimate project timelines more reliably.

Remote & Hybrid Workforces

Distributed teams rely on these platforms for visibility into daily activities, fostering accountability and asynchronous collaboration without micromanagement.

Consulting and Legal Firms

Firms leverage detailed time tracking for client matter management, ensuring compliance with strict billing guidelines and maximizing resource utilization.

Product Manufacturing

Manufacturers track time spent on production stages and maintenance tasks to identify inefficiencies, control labor costs, and improve throughput.

Task Management & Time Tracking FAQs

What is the average cost of a task management and time tracking system?

Pricing varies significantly based on features, deployment model, and team size, typically ranging from $5 to $20+ per user per month. Enterprise-grade platforms with advanced analytics and integrations command higher fees. The total cost includes subscription fees, implementation, and potential training.

What are the key features to look for in a time tracking software?

Essential features include automated time capture, detailed reporting, integration with project management tools, and mobile accessibility. Also prioritize invoicing capabilities, idle time detection, and robust permissions for managing sensitive data. The right feature set depends on your specific workflow and compliance needs.

How does task management software improve team productivity?

It provides a centralized view of all work, clarifying priorities and deadlines to reduce confusion and context-switching. By visualizing workloads and progress, it helps identify bottlenecks early. This leads to better resource allocation, fewer missed deadlines, and a more focused, accountable team.

What is the implementation timeline for these platforms?

Implementation can take from a few days for simple, cloud-based tools to several weeks for complex enterprise deployments. Timeline depends on data migration needs, custom integration requirements, and the scale of user training. A phased rollout is often recommended for larger organizations.

What are common mistakes when selecting a task management tool?

Common pitfalls include choosing overly complex software that teams reject, neglecting essential integrations, and underestimating training needs. Another mistake is focusing solely on price without considering long-term scalability and the total cost of ownership, including support and updates.
